Description
United States - Remote - Salary Range 98-105K
Job Brief
The Project Manager will organize, manage and plan implementation projects. They will provide technical expertise and leadership to projects and process improvements. This includes engaging resources and ensuring quality control throughout projects along with providing expertise and guidance during system development, from conceptualization to implementation.
Responsibilities
Leads an interdepartmental team to complete an assigned project on time, to specifications, and with accuracy and efficiency.
Outlines the tasks involved in the project and delegates accordingly.
Assists with cost analysis, estimating expected costs for the project.
Addresses questions, concerns, and/or complaints throughout the project.
Acts as a liaison between company, customers, and vendors.
Communicates and collaborates with sales and marketing teams to provide training and information required to promote and sell new projects, programs, and systems.
Ensures compliance with federal, state, local, industry, contractual, and company regulations, standards, specifications, and best practices.
Leads regular status meetings with project team.
Works closely with other departments to coordinate and perform a variety of projects.
5% overnight travel as required.
Requirements
Bachelor’s degree in related technical field.
Minimum of 2 years of associated work experience preferred.
Minimum of 2 years’ experience implementing software and IT knowledge preferred.
3+ years’ experience in Support; or related experience and/or training.
Strong knowledge in PM applications and tools preferred.
PMP certified or in progress preferred.
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
Extremely proficient in Microsoft Office Suite or related software programs.
